Output 37be760384a5655f1beee63b6b08089789600ce9c3566cdfdca372de2fb558be:0

value
911716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90b8467db6881204ba44a478ca20feb64668113 OP_EQUAL
address
3L23YLBBWJtPvHjrGYcDms4B1epqvv3JxP
transaction
37be760384a5655f1beee63b6b08089789600ce9c3566cdfdca372de2fb558be
confirmations
452
spent
true